Ohio State and Wisconsin are in a good spot after rolling in blowouts during Week 4.

For the Badgers, they welcomed Michigan to Madison in a showdown of top-15 opponents. A close game was expected, but it did not turn out that way. Jonathan Taylor and company steamrolled Jim Harbaugh’s squad and looks impressive moving forward.

For the Buckeyes, they eclipsed 70 points in a dominant performance against Miami (OH). Justin Fields, Chase Young, and the rest of Ryan Day’s team were nearly flawless in the victory.

Coming out of Week 4, the two teams checked in on the top 10 of ESPN’s Playoff Predictor. Ohio State is in the third spot behind Clemson and Alabama with a 59% chance to make the Playoff. Wisconsin checked in at No. 7 with a 20% chance to make the Playoff, but there is plenty of room to improve on that mark moving forward. Penn State cracked the top 10 with a 7% chance to make the Playoff.
